TITAN is an EU funded initiative aiming to counter the effects of online disinformation and fake news through an AI-enabled chatbot which supports users critical thinking in investigating content accuracy.
This presentation by IPT introduced the TITAN team to the concept of the Socratic Method for logical investigation.

3. Socratic Method in Education
ΙΝΣΤΙΤΟΥΤΟ ΦΙΛΟΣΟΦΙΑΣ & ΤΕΧΝΟΛΟΓΙΑΣ
Λ. Χρονοπούλου 20, 17455, Άλιμος
Τ: +30 2109816297 – info@ipt.gr
• Not a fixed procedure.
• Systematic, disciplined, challenging, provocative (different
from common questioning and simple conversations).
• An open dialogue between a facilitator and person / group.
• Not a teaching method in the conventional way
("undeniable" facts and truths or "memorization”)
• An open-teaching with shared dialogues between people
where both are responsible for pushing the dialogue
forward through questioning

6. ΙΝΣΤΙΤΟΥΤΟ ΦΙΛΟΣΟΦΙΑΣ & ΤΕΧΝΟΛΟΓΙΑΣ
Λ. Χρονοπούλου 20, 17455, Άλιμος
Τ: +30 2109816297 – info@ipt.gr
1. Wonder (pose questions: what is courage, what is
virtue)
2. Hypothesis (answer: opinion or claim, the hypothesis
of the dialogue is defined);
3. Elenchus (hypothesis is challenged, counter-claims,
counter-examples)
4. Accept / Reject (hypothesis accepted or rejected by
the participants themselves)
5. Action (inquiry results and findings)
(Boghossian, 2012)

8. Socratic Method in Educational Technology
ΙΝΣΤΙΤΟΥΤΟ ΦΙΛΟΣΟΦΙΑΣ & ΤΕΧΝΟΛΟΓΙΑΣ
Λ. Χρονοπούλου 20, 17455, Άλιμος
Τ: +30 2109816297 – info@ipt.gr
(1) (quasi-Socratic): encourages participation and promote
intellectual curiosity and the joy of learning. Examples: digital
applications such as "Socrative", "Nearpod" and "ClassDojo"
(Dunn, 2014)
(2) (real-Socratic): encourages critical thinking and intelligent
coaching (probing questions, explore relationships among
concepts and ideas, play devil’s advocate). Examples: Intelligent
Tutoring System (ITS)
Le & Huse, N. (2016)
